    Hey sis Lebo, in the interest of destigmatising mental health we also need to be mindful of the language we use. Some politically correct and less stigmatizing terms are: Pyschiatric Healthcare Facilities/ Mental Health Units/Behavioural Healthcare Facilities. "Mental Institution" only feeds into the stigma.
